To: No One Special

I use Google to search by entering the search terms and site limiter in the Google searchbox (omit the “”):

“type general search terms site:freerepublic.com”

The above would search for ‘type’ and ‘general’ and ‘search’ and ‘terms’ on freerepublic.com
